They went to Gilead and to Kadesh in Syria.[a] Then they went to Dan, Ijon,[b] and on toward Sidon. They came to the fortress of Tyre, then went through every town of the Hivites and the Canaanites. Finally, they went to Beersheba in the Southern Desert of Judah. After they had gone through the whole land, they went back to Jerusalem. It had taken them 9 months and 20 days.

They went to Gilead and the region of Tahtim Hodshi, and on to Dan Jaan and around toward Sidon.(A) Then they went toward the fortress of Tyre(B) and all the towns of the Hivites(C) and Canaanites. Finally, they went on to Beersheba(D) in the Negev(E) of Judah.

After they had gone through the entire land, they came back to Jerusalem at the end of nine months and twenty days.
